### Step 4: Configure the rotation service

Before deploying Spindlekey to the staging cluster, create a `.env` file in the release directory by copying `env.sample`. Verify that the rotation interval and the Calbright vault endpoint match the values in the deployment checklist. Do not commit this file to source control. Finally, the service requires an authorization credential for the vault; append the following line to the `.env` file:

sealed setting: VAULT_KEY20=c8ea1e419912889df6b4

## Deployment

Our Quillhaven build agents occasionally drift out of sync with each other, and because artifact signing embeds a timestamp, even a few seconds of clock skew can cause the verifier to reject an otherwise valid build. Always confirm agents have synced before promoting a release; the pipeline checks this automatically, but the check can be overridden, so be careful. The skew tolerance and sync intervals the pipeline enforces come from the following values.

settings of tagef-bawif:
DRUIX_HOST=druix.zemvarlabs.internal
DRUIX_PORT=8000

Welcome to the Larkmoor deploy crew! Canary gates on Pipeline Finch are simple: a canary holds at 5% traffic for 20 minutes, and auto-rolls back if error rate beats baseline by 0.5%. Don't force-promote unless two leads sign off. If the gating dashboard itself is down, you'll need the recovery passphrase to unlock manual promotion, which is kept right below.

unlock words, kagef-taduf: fenir-quenix-norwyn-sorvan-gormir-gorir-fraok

The Tallowbrook CSV Import Wizard exposes a staged upload flow that plugin authors must follow exactly: create an import session, stream row chunks of no more than 5,000 records, then commit. Each stage validates column mappings against the schema your plugin declared at registration, and any mismatch aborts the session without partial writes. All three endpoints require authentication on every request. For sandbox testing against the Fernhollow environment, authenticate each call with the bearer token shown below.

session JWT of yawep-yawep = eyJhbGciOiJIUzI1NiIsInR5cCI6IkpXVCJ9.eyJzdWIiOiI3pWF3_In0.aXYsHiog